Feature Organization: FedEx Ground Package System, Inc.

Sustainability Coordinator/Representative: Gaylyn Frosini, Environmental Compliance Specialist

Employees: nearly 50,000 full and part-time employees in the U.S. and 900 in Canada plus 12,500 independent contractors and their employees who make up the delivery force.

Notable sustainability projects:

FedEx Ground is committed to reducing its environmental impact and being a good corporate citizen in the communities in which we work and live. In 2008, the Sustainability Steering Committee lead by the company’s Chief Operations Officer and Senior Vice President of Operations and Engineering was created to review, track and analyze current and proposed sustainability initiatives by gathering the Managing Directors for all key departments on a monthly basis. Through the development of this steering committee, the organization is able to efficiently review and implement numerous initiatives that reduce its impact and lower operational costs. Two of these projects are highlighted below.

FedEx Ground completed the largest roof-mounted solar power installation in North America at its Woodbridge, NJ hub in December 2009. The solar power system consists of 12,400 solar panels covering 3.3 acres of the roof and will produce an estimated 2.7 million kilowatt hours of electricity per year which is expected to supply 30% of the facility’s total annual electricity consumption. This alternative energy project is estimated to have an annual greenhouse gas reduction savings equivalent to removing over 300 passenger cars from the road each year.

In 2006, FedEx Ground created a corporate recycling program titled Ground Green. Through the use of its “hub and spoke” type of operations, waste plastic film is transferred from over 500 field stations to our hub locations where it is baled then recycled through several national recycling vendors. In turn, we purchase new smalls bags from these vendors which consist of 30% of our recycled plastics. In addition to the plastic recycling program, FedEx Ground facilities recycle paper, scrap metal, aluminum, glass, plastics, wood pallets, electronics, and cardboard where feasible. Since the implementation of the Ground Green program, more than 18,000 tons of waste materials have been recycled which is equivalent to diverting over 1,900 trash collection trucks from landfills.

Sustainability-related facts:

  • Annual kWh & GHG reduction due to lighting retrofits: 3,453,258 kWh; 649.22 CO2e
  • Estimated annual alternative energy produced: 2.7 Million kWh (Solar)
  • Total GHG reduction through corporate recycling program: 21,488 tons CO2e
  • 5-Minute Automatic Idle Shutdown for yard tractors and switchers: 60,329 gallons of fuel saved annually; 608 tons CO2e annual savings
  • Installation of occupancy light switch sensors in all conference rooms and restrooms at Corporate office: 71,885 kWh annually; 50.74 tons CO2e annually
